FETTUCCINE IN LOBSTER BROTH WITH SHRIMP, CRAWFISH AND CRABMEAT
Steps:
- Heat olive oil in a medium saucepan over medium heat. Add the onion, carrot and celery and cook until soft. Add the lobster shells and cook for five minutes. Raise the heat to high, add the wine and cook until reduced by half. Add the water, garlic, tomatoes, bay leaf and parsley and bring to a boil. Reduce heat and simmer for 40 minutes. Strain into a clean medium saucepan. Bring the broth to a boil and reduce to 2 cups, whisk in the creme fraiche and chipotle puree. Add the chives and season with salt and pepper to taste.
- For the Sauteed Shrimp: Heat oil in a medium saute pan over high heat. Season the shrimp with salt and pepper to taste. Saute the shrimp for 1 to 2 minutes on each side until just cooked through.
- For the Crawfish: Place water in a medium stockpot with plenty of salt and bring to a boil. Add the bay, thyme, garlic and peppercorns and bring to a boil. Reduce heat and let simmer for 10 minutes. Add the crawfish and let cook 5 minutes, turn off the heat and let the crawfish cool in the liquid, drain. Remove meat and coarsely chop.
- To assemble: Divide pasta among 8 bowls. Ladle over the broth. Place 2 shrimp in each bowl and divide the crawfish meat and crabmeat among the bowls. Sprinkle with fresh chives.

LONG LIFE NOODLES WITH CRABMEAT
Provided by Food Network
Categories side-dish
Time 45m
Yield 4 to 5 servings (10 to 12 banq
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Remove any shells or cartilage from crabmeat. Set aside.
- Mix 3 tablespoons cornstarch with 3 tablespoons water in a small bowl. Set aside. Bring 2 quarts water to a boil in a large pot. Add 1 teaspoon salt and 1 tablespoon vegetable oil to water. Place the dry noodles in boiling water and boil for 2 minutes. Drain well and place on platter.
- Heat a wok to hot on medium heat and add the remaining vegetable oil and minced garlic. Stir until garlic becomes fragrant. Add the chicken broth and bring to boiling; stir in the cornstarch mixture. Stir until thickened, and then add the crabmeat, oyster sauce, sesame oil, and yellow chives. Season with salt and pepper, to taste. Turn off heat and pour sauce over the noodles. Serve.
STUFFED VEAL ROULADE WITH CRABMEAT
Provided by Food Network
Time 30m
Yield 6 servings
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Chill all ingredients well. Combine ground veal and ground pork in a food processor and process until smooth (approximately 1 minute using a pulse). Add cream, egg, tarragon and parsley into veal and pork mixture, process until smooth and well combined. Transfer into a mixing bowl. Add picked crabmeat. Keep refrigerated until ready to use. To assemble: Layout veal scaloppine. Place approximately 2 ounces of crab filling down on the center of veal from end to end. Carefully fold ends over and roll. Secure with butcher twine or a 6-inch skewer. Season with salt and pepper. Sear veal roulades until golden brown. Transfer to a baking pan and finish in a 375-degree oven for approximately 15 to 18 minutes until cooked through.
GRANDMA'S PEA SOUP
My grandma's pea soup recipe was a family favorite. What makes it different from any other pea soups I have tried is the addition of whole peas, spaetzle-like "dumplings" and sausage. Try it once and you'll be hooked. -Carole Talcott, Dahinda, Illinois
Provided by Taste of Home
Time 3h
Yield 16 servings (4 quarts).
Number Of Ingredients 18
Steps:
- Cover peas with water and soak overnight. Drain, rinse and place in a Dutch oven. , Add ham bone, water and remaining soup ingredients except sausage and dumplings.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and simmer 2 to 2-1/2 hours. , Remove ham bone and skim fat. Remove meat from bone; dice. Add ham and, if desired, sausage to pan. , For dumplings, place flour in a small bowl. Make a depression in the center of the flour; add egg and water and stir until smooth. , Place a colander with 3/16-in.-diameter holes over simmering soup; transfer dough to the colander and press through with a wooden spoon. Cook, uncovered, 10-15 minutes. Discard bay leaf. Freeze Option: Prepare soup without dumplings and freeze in serving-size portions to enjoy for months to come.

MINTED ENGLISH PEA SOUP
This delicious soup recipe is courtesy of Patrick O'Connell from the Inn at Little Washington and can also be made with lobster and orange.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Soups, Stews & Stocks Soup Recipes
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- Melt butter in a large saucepan over medium heat. Add onion, leek, and celery, and cook until soft. Add potatoes and 7 cups vegetable stock; bring to a boil. Reduce heat and simmer until potatoes are soft, 10 to 15 minutes. Remove from heat.
- Prepare an ice-water bath. Fill another large saucepan with water and bring to a boil over high heat. Add salt and return to a boil. Add peas and cook until tender, about 5 minutes. Drain and immediately transfer peas to ice-water bath to cool. Drain and add to saucepan with vegetables and stock.
- Working in batches, puree the soup in the jar of a blender or bowl of a food processor. Strain liquid twice through a fine mesh sieve into another large saucepan. Add 1 cup of heavy cream and place saucepan over low heat. Season with salt, pepper, and sugar. Tie mint together using kitchen twine and add to saucepan; let steep for 10 to 15 minutes. Remove mint and discard. If soup seems too thick, add some of the remaining vegetable stock to thin.
- In a medium bowl, whisk remaining 1/2 cup heavy cream until soft peaks form. Gently fold into the warmed soup. Serve immediately.

CHILLED ENGLISH PEA SOUP RECIPE WITH CRAB & MEYER …
From foodandwine.com
5/5 (1)Total Time 2 hrs 45 minsCategory Dinner
- Heat oil in a large saucepan over low. Add onion, celery, garlic, and 1 teaspoon salt. Sauté until onions are translucent, 10 to 12 minutes. Add 2 cups milk; bring to a simmer, and cook until vegetables are tender, about 10 minutes. Remove from heat; let cool slightly.
- While vegetables are cooking, prepare a large bowl of ice water and bring a large pot of water to a boil over high. Add peas to pot, return to a boil, and cook until peas are bright green and just tender, about 2 minutes. Remove peas with a slotted spoon, and immediately plunge into ice water. Return water in pot to a boil, add watercress, and cook until bright green and wilted, about 1 minute. Plunge watercress into ice water. Drain peas and watercress; set aside peas. Squeeze watercress to remove as much water as possible.
- Combine peas, watercress, and remaining 1 cup milk in a blender. Process on high until smooth. Working in batches if necessary, add onion mixture to blender; process on high until smooth. Pour through a fine wire-mesh strainer into a bowl; discard solids. Season with remaining 1 teaspoon salt and white pepper. Cover and chill until ready to serve, at least 2 hours or up to 1 day.
- Whisk together crème fraîche, 1 tablespoon chives, 1 tablespoon dill, tarragon, lemon zest, and 2 tablespoons lemon juice in a medium bowl. Gently fold in crab. Chill until ready to serve, at least 30 minutes or up to 2 hours.
